Things I see wrong with the patch.
First, MPTournament.biq refers to 1.18 patch.
Also it still has a Radio tech implemented.
This is also true for all other BIQ files added with Conquests.
Like Cheaper Upgrades.biq, MPFastCiv3Conquests.biq, No Civ Traits.biq, No Unique Units.biq, Quick Civ.biq, With Plague.biq, etc... They all need to be changed to reflect the newest rules.
Second, even conquests.biq is not done properly.
It still has Radio tech in its list, but as non-era tech which is added to all civs at start.
Should be deleted, since it gives some bugs, like starting game with Radio or Radio in Civilopedia.
Third, Civilopeida.txt isn't changed to reflect that Radio tech is removed. Which means that "Enables Radar Towers" entry needs to be moved from Radio to Electronics.
Fourth, as alexman reported, it looks that Civ3Conquests.exe looks for science_industrial_new.pcx for industrial era, which gives error in all scenarios. It should look to science_industrial.pcx instead, and science_industrial_new.pcx needs to replace science_industrial.pcx
Fifth: How this passed Q&A???
I fully expect 1.21 to be released ASAP to fix these issuses.
Optional: When we are there, maybe some other easy things could be fixed.
-Like adding WWII Paratrooper in list of units with ZOC in Civilopedia
-removing offense AI flag from Musketeer (PtW leftover, when it had attack of 3)
-fixing bug with Inca leader being targetable by Stl. Fighter stealth attack (this maybe is not bug since stealth attack doesn't work for air units anyway)
-and if any conquests.biq changes are done, then adding them to other optional BIQs should be done too

Dear Friends:
I am the Head Admin of CIV3Players, the world's largest CIV3 Conquests ladder league with almost 600 ranked players.
We tried running with the 1.20 patch last night and gave up after 2 hours of testing.
There is a horrible bug that renders this patch WORTHLESS and UNUSABLE for the Multiplayer Community.
It is impossible to restart/reload a GAME. When you restart a previously begun 1.20 game, you are presented with a 90% black screen and a total loss of functionality. The game cannot be restarted no matter which of the 5 previous Autosave files you use. I consider it irresponsible that such basic functionality like this wasn't tested.
I am not referring to old 1.15 games not being able to be reloaded (the readme tells you that won't work). I am referring to all future 1.20 game being non-restartable.
We have advised all our users to go back to 1.15. The vendor needs to correct this major flaw and reissue a 1.21 patch as soon as possible.
